Two breathe their last at polling stations!

5 August 2020 07:52 pm

Two senior citizens who arrived to cast their vote at the Bekkegama Junior School and Aluthepola Walagamba Maha Vidyalaya polling stations, breathed their last at the polling stations this morning.

The police officers on duty at the Bekkegama Junior School polling station rushed 81-year-old Minuwanpitiyage Garlin Peiris to the Panadura Hospital where he was pronounced dead. The deceased was a resident of Bekkegama and a father of two.

The other deceased was J.C. Seelawathi aged 69, and a resident of Wagouwa.

The woman, who was a heart patient, had been rushed to Minuwangoda Hospital after having collapsed at Aluthepola Walagamba Maha Vidyalaya polling station. (Saman Kariyawsam, Kusal Chamath and Pushpakumara Mallawarachchi)
